The Juvale Thin Flat Reed Coil is a 0.63-inch wide, 118-foot long premium soft maple weaving material designed for basket making and crafts. Its smooth texture and natural durability make it ideal for intricate, customizable projects, while its generous length supports multiple creations. Perfect for both beginners and pros, it soaks easily for flexible weaving and pairs well with crochet hook size 5.
